Specifications
Insulation Color: Black
Contact Finish Thickness - Post: --
Contact Material: Beryllium Copper
Contact Shape: Circular
Insulation Material: Liquid Crystal Polymer (LCP)
Applications: --
Voltage Rating: --
Current Rating: --
Features: --
Ingress Protection: --
Mated Stacking Heights: --
Contact Finish - Post: Tin
Material Flammability Rating: UL94 V-0
Operating Temperature: -55°C ~ 125°C
Contact Length - Post: 0.365" (9.27mm)
Insulation Height: 0.300" (7.62mm)
Series: ESS
Contact Finish Thickness - Mating: --
Contact Finish - Mating: Tin
Fastening Type: Push-Pull
Termination: Solder
Mounting Type: Through Hole
Row Spacing - Mating: --
Number of Rows: 1
Pitch - Mating: 0.100" (2.54mm)
Number of Positions Loaded: All
Number of Positions: 32
Style: Board to Board
Contact Type: Female Socket
Connector Type: Elevated Socket
Part Status: Active
Packaging: Bulk
